Welcome to supporting Moonpull, our tide-table widget! Most tickets are about stale predictions — usually the customer's embed is cached, so have them hard-refresh first. If the widget shows dashes instead of tide heights, the upstream harmonic feed is down and you can confirm via the status endpoint. For anything deeper, you'll query the internal prediction service directly from the support console. To do that, authenticate with the service key provided below.

gateway credential: kto3_qfe

### Changed defaults

PayWeft payroll exports now default to the v3 column layout: ISO dates, separate tax columns, UTF-8 only. Legacy v2 exports remain available via the format dropdown until Q3. Customers on scheduled exports were migrated automatically. If a customer reports broken imports, check their scheduler settings first. The new defaults applied to every tenant are as follows.

deployment values, yadug-bawif:
[framir]
team = pelox
access_code = ac_a38ab2
owner = tamion.julael
host = framir.tolvaqlabs.test
port = 11211
peer = tammir.zemvargrid.local
salt = 2215ef03
pin = 1541

TURN-208: Gatevale turnstile counters at the Merrow Field pilot double-count when a rotation reverses mid-cycle. Attendance totals drift roughly 2% high per event. The debounce window fix is implemented, reviewed by Ilsa, and soak-tested across two simulated match days without drift. Ready for your cut; the candidate build is identified below.

trace token, tagag-tafog: htk6_5ed18c

## Runbook: Account Recovery — Pool Exhaustion (Tindervane)

If account-recovery requests stall, check the auth DB pool. Symptom: connections pinned at max (80), queue depth rising. Restart the pooler on auth-2, then drain stuck sessions. Pooler restart requires operator unlock; enter the recovery passphrase recorded immediately below.

vault phrase of tajeg-tageg = pelix-druix-holius-briael-zorwyn-frawyn-fraox-norok-drueth-aldiel

**FAQ: Can I use the canteen in the Drossel & Hane building?**

Yes. Our canteen on Level 2 opens through to Drossel & Hane at lunchtime via the link bridge. Contractors may eat there between 12:00 and 14:00. Carry your visitor lanyard at all times and return through the same bridge door. The door on their side locks automatically, so you will need the code below.

staff pass of kawip-hawef = bdg-QLP-2